A NEW car park for Malvern town centre will take another step towards completion next month.

Two buildings on land behind the Unicorn on Belle Vue Terrace were demolished last year and on Monday, September 3, the demolition of the former exhaust, tyre and battery centre will begin to make way for the 40-place car park.

Pete McLaren, property services manager at Malvern Hills District Council, said that the demolition would take about three to four weeks. He added that tenders for the construction of the car park were due in at the end of August.

"I can't say when it will all be done, we won't know until the building contract has been tendered," he said.

MHDC has a budget of £195,000 for the work and has agreed to create an access ramp to land behind Robson Ward Kitchens, which could provide up to 100 more spaces at a later date.
